R. Ditmar - Art Nouveau lamp - glass, bronze and cast iron
Very beautiful and richly decorated ceiling lamp from the late 19th century. The cast iron is beautifully styled. The lamp can vary in height and for this purpose has been provided with a counterweight. The 3 side elements were partially carried out as a kind of chain for this purpose (picture 23) and are guided over the three rollers during adjusting so that it always runs smoothly. The company had patented this(see photo 24). The burner is fitted with a plate bearing the words "brillant meteor brenner lampe patente 1886 89 R Ditmar Vienna.
The lamp is in very good condition for its age. The glass shade is in flawless condition. The oil burner has not been tested by me. Only the edge where the shade rests has a small and apparently very old restoration (photo 18)
The company Ditmar was a major manufacturer of oil lamps in the second half of the 19th century. The company Brothers Ditmar was founded in 1841 in Vienna by Rudolph and Friedrich Ditmar. In 1895, about 700 people were employed.
Sizes: the lamp is adjustable in height from 130 cm to 180 cm and measures 43 cm at its widest.
